Many PS2 games utilized interlacing as part of their render pipeline and if this is not disabled the game will look blurry on a modern display. It's also worthwhile to look up any widescreen or no-interlacing patches that may be available for your games. For every game you decide to emulate, check with the PCSX2 Wiki for more compatibility info and contribute your own if possible.
